Split ServerTreePanel into focused collaborator classes

Extract cell rendering, right-aligned group-icon-strip painting, the
drop-indicator JTree subclass, and drag-and-drop handling out of
ServerTreePanel into ServerTreeCellRenderer, DropIndicatorTree, and
ServerTreeDragAndDrop, leaving ServerTreePanel as the coordinator
(706 -> 284 lines). Pure refactor, no behavior change.
